About adding a watermark to a video in the browser
A logo bug in the corner, a brand mark on an outro, a photographer's or creator's credit — this burns an image you provide onto every frame of a video, at whatever corner, size and opacity you choose, so it travels with the video wherever it's posted.
The logo image is drawn onto each frame at a fixed position and size, then the video is re-encoded back into the same container it came in as. A PNG with a transparent background gives the cleanest result, since the logo's own shape is what shows — no background box around it. Everything happens on your device through WebCodecs; nothing is uploaded.

What image formats work for the logo?+
PNG, WebP or JPG. PNG with a transparent background looks best, since the logo is drawn exactly as-is over the video.
Can I make the watermark semi-transparent?+
Yes — the opacity slider goes from barely-there to fully solid.
Which browsers work?+
Chrome, Edge and Safari 17+ — burning it in needs WebCodecs.
